Colorado Springs is nicknamed the “Little London.” This name comes from a time when British culture and impacts were strong in the city's early years. Nestled along Fountain Creek and just 70 miles south of Denver, Colorado Springs is more than just a picturesque city – it's a hub of positive growth and exciting activities. As the second-most populous city in Colorado and a vital part of the Front Range Urban Corridor, Colorado Springs has evolved beyond its military town roots into a thriving destination for a diverse and educated population.
